What Is Value Engineering in Construction?

Value engineering is a way to reduce cost without sacrificing functionality. It’s a proven method for maximizing value and keeping things under budget, which is important to you as a contractor.  

To be clear, value engineering works best if started early—in the design phase—and carried throughout the project. Using Value Engineering for Flooring Projects: An Example

Choosing the right flooring options for your project is all about value engineering. Let’s say you’re working on a home where the client wants the look and feel of hardwood floors.

Natural hardwood can be a bit pricey, while engineered hardwood can be fashioned to deliver the same premium look as natural hardwood, without the cost. Not only that, but it offers easier installation (less installation time) and more longevity.
